Playing Music

Tip: We recommend that you
create a folder or folders for saving
all your music files for ease of use
and file organization
Music or audio files can be played whether you are inside
"MyMediaShare" or "My Device". Simply locate the music or
audio file that you would like to play. Click on the file and
your music will automatically play.
Note: Please consult your Kindle
mobile device manual to check
whether it will support the music/
audio files that you would like to
play
Use the following icons to control music playback:
When clicked, the current music that is playing will
restart at 0.00. When double-clicked, it will play the previous
music.
When clicked, it will play the next music file.
When clicked, it will start playing the music or audio
file.
When clicked, the will pause/stop playing the music.
There are five play modes:
1.
Repeat all songs: the music or audio files
will be played in sequence, and it will only stop
playing when the pause button is clicked. (Default
Mode)
2.
Play current song: the current music that is
playing will be stopped, and playing progress will

return back to 0.00.
3.
Repeat current song: the player will always
play the current song, and it will only stop playing
when the pause button is clicked.
4.
Shuffle all songs: the music or audio files will
be played randomly.
5.
Play current list: the music or audio files will
be played sequentially.
Tip: You can click and hold then
slide music progress button to fast-
forward or rewind the music
Tip: You can exit Music Player
Interface at any time and the
music will continue to play in the
background

Playing Video

Tip: We recommend that you
create a folder or folders for saving
all your movie files for ease of use
and file organization
Movie or video files can be played whether you are in
"MyMediaShare" or "My Device". Simply locate the movie or
video file that you would like to play. Click on the file and the
list of installed movie players will appear.
Note: Please consult your Kindle
Fire manual and video player
application manual for supported
video encoding methods and file
types, and for a description of the
player control panel
The player control panel will vary depending on the installed
movie player you have selected.
